Hello All, I'm having this issue that I haven't been able to fix yet: I have 3 web cams (#1,#2 and #3) all of them are recognized by Yawcam and when I run the first instance of the app I can switch between any of them without any issue. If I run a second instance I can switch between the remaining 2 cams, as expected without any issue. However, when I run the third instance and switch to the third free cam I get the error message that I can't connect to the camera although it's not selected by any of the previous two instances of the application. I already tried replicating three folders in "program files" with 3 config files without any success. Any help would be greatly appreciated as I'm having this problem for several weeks already.

Are you using USB cameras?
It's common that the bandwidth on the USB port is to low if you connect multiple cameras on the same USB controller.
Try to connect the cameras to different USB ports (preferably both in the front and in the back of your computer), and see if that makes any difference.

You usually get the connection problems you describe when the USB controller is overloaded.

Thanks for your reply Malun. You're right I think that's the issue. Unfortunately is a kind of old computer (1.7 Ghz, 1 G Ram) with only three available usb ports which are located all together. I tried with an external usb hub having the same result (logically !!).
I reckon I'm left with no options than having only 2 cams or replacing the old laptop.

It usually helps to reduce the image size.

Try this:
1) Start Yawcam instance #1.
2) Select camera #1 by clicking "Change to device..." and choose the format with the smallest image size.
3) Start Yawcam instance #2.
4) Select camera #2 by clicking "Change to device..." and choose the format with the smallest image size.
5) Start Yawcam instance #3.
6) Select camera #3 by clicking "Change to device..." and choose the format with the smallest image size.

Could you connect to all cameras?
If so, then try to make the size bigger step by step again until you find the limit.
